Hustrulid Technologies Incorporated is pleased to announce the release of
Chute Maven
Material Flow Modeling
This next generation of modeling bulk material flow through transfer stations using the discrete element method allows designers to evaluate chutes with relative ease. ChuteMaven is built so the engineering firms who design the systems can easily analyze existing or new transfer stations. Designers can have a model running in a few minutes by simply importing a 3-D AutoCAD file and setting a few parameters. Avi files and data exporting allow for informative and beautiful presentations.
